Challenges Ahead

Despite the promising aspects of this technology, several challenges persist:

  • Cost of Launch and Maintenance: Establishing and maintaining data centers in space requires substantial financial investment and logistical planning.
  • Technological Hurdles: Advancements in satellite technology and data transmission methods are critical to overcoming current limitations.
  • Regulatory Frameworks: There is a need for international agreements and regulations to manage space-based operations effectively.
